  • Carlton: Located a mere 644m from the University of Melbourne, Carlton is a charming suburb that offers a warm, welcoming atmosphere. With a steady flow of visitors year-round, especially in March to April and July, Carlton is an attractive spot for families and business travellers. Explore the local shopping centres that cater to diverse tastes, or visit educational institutions that enrich the community. The area is dotted with historic buildings and lively streets, creating an inviting environment for leisurely strolls. Carlton's proximity to the stadium means you can easily catch an event, adding excitement to your stay.

Shopping

For your shopping experience near the University of Melbourne, visit the vibrant Queen Victoria Market, only 1.3km away, offering fresh produce and unique souvenirs. Melbourne Central, 1.6km away, features a mix of shops and entertainment. If you're up for a drive, check out Lightning Ridge Opal Mines, 1.6km away, for stunning opal gifts.

Recreation

Marvel Stadium offers an exhilarating atmosphere for sports enthusiasts, just 3.2km from the University of Melbourne. Enjoy live events at the Sidney Myer Music Bowl, also 3.2km away, where entertainment thrives. For family fun, the Melbourne Sports & Aquatic Centre, located 4.8km away, provides a range of aquatic activities.

Adventure

Explore the Merri Creek Trail, a picturesque hiking experience only 3.2km from the University of Melbourne, offering stunning outdoor scenery and adventure vibes. Alternatively, enjoy the Tan Track, located 4.8km away, perfect for leisurely outdoor strolls. For a unique experience, take a scenic flight with Melbourne Seaplanes, 9.7km away, showcasing breathtaking views.

Nightlife

The nightlife around the University of Melbourne is vibrant and diverse. Catch a show at the iconic Princess Theatre, enjoy a performance at Her Majesty's Theatre, or laugh it up at the Comedy Theatre, all within 1.6km. Each venue offers a unique blend of entertainment and culture.

Best time to go to University of Melbourne

The best time to visit University of Melbourne is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ain (dry).
